Angola Inflation December 2025

Angola: Inflation slows in December from November

Latest reading: Consumer prices were up 15.7% on a year-on-year basis in December, following a 16.6% increase in the previous month. December’s reading was the weakest since September 2023.

Relative to the prior month’s data, there were reduced price pressures for food and beverages (+16.1% on a year-on-year basis vs +16.9% in November), transport (+19.2% vs +19.8% in November), housing, water, electricity and fuel (+17.0% vs +17.2% in November), health (+17.4% vs +19.0% in November) and clothing (+14.3% vs +15.7% in November).

Finally, consumer prices increased 0.95% in December on a month-on-month basis, following a 0.85% rise in the prior month.
